VAC Series Carbide 4-Flute Square End Mill (Extra-Long Model)
MISUMI
[Features]
·Demonstrates high performance in processing general steel, SUS304, and heat-treated steel (up to 50 HRC)
·Effective for processing deep parts due to extra long blade length
·Ultra-fine particle cemented carbide base material and coating with excellent adhesion and heat resistance are adopted
·Can process heat-treated steel up to 50HRC
·Optimal for machining in low to medium rotation range due to the general-purpose 30° helix angle
·Coating with excellent lubricity provides stable abrasion resistance and improves shape accuracy of workpiece (VAC coating has weak electrical conductivity. Please be careful when using an electrical tool setter.)
·Can be regrinded. Please refer to the page dedicated to "regrinding service" for usage procedures, range of services, prices, etc.
